Find a Lawyer in TajikistanAbout Technology Transactions Law in Tajikistan:
Technology Transactions in Tajikistan refer to legal agreements related to the acquisition, development, use, or licensing of technology. These transactions are crucial for businesses looking to protect their intellectual property rights and ensure compliance with local laws.

Local Laws Overview:
In Tajikistan, Technology Transactions are governed by the Civil Code, which outlines the rights and obligations of parties involved in such agreements. Additionally, the Law on Electronic Documents and Digital Signatures sets out relevant provisions for electronic transactions. It is essential to comply with these laws to avoid legal issues.
Frequently Asked Questions:
1. What are the key elements of a technology transfer agreement?
A technology transfer agreement should specify the rights and obligations of both parties, the scope of technology being transferred, payment terms, confidentiality provisions, and any dispute resolution mechanisms.
2. How can I protect my intellectual property rights in Technology Transactions?
You can protect your intellectual property rights by including confidentiality and non-disclosure clauses in agreements, registering patents or trademarks, and enforcing your rights through legal channels if necessary.
3. Are electronic signatures legally binding in Tajikistan?
Yes, electronic signatures are legally binding in Tajikistan under the Law on Electronic Documents and Digital Signatures. They have the same legal validity as handwritten signatures.
4. What are the consequences of breaching a technology transfer agreement?
Breaching a technology transfer agreement can lead to legal action, such as compensation claims, injunctions, or termination of the agreement. It is crucial to comply with the terms of the agreement to avoid such consequences.

6. What are the requirements for transferring technology across borders in Tajikistan?
Transferring technology across borders in Tajikistan may require compliance with export control regulations, intellectual property laws, and any relevant international agreements. It is advisable to seek legal advice to navigate these requirements successfully.
7. Can I modify a technology transfer agreement after it has been signed?
Modifying a technology transfer agreement after it has been signed requires the consent of all parties involved. It is recommended to document any changes in writing and ensure that the modifications are legally enforceable.
8. How can I resolve disputes in technology transactions in Tajikistan?
Disputes in technology transactions can be resolved through negotiation, mediation, arbitration, or court proceedings. It is advisable to include dispute resolution clauses in agreements to specify the mechanism for resolving conflicts.
9. Are there any specific regulations for technology transactions in certain industries in Tajikistan?
There may be industry-specific regulations for technology transactions in sectors such as telecommunications, banking, or healthcare. It is essential to be aware of any relevant regulations and ensure compliance with them in your transactions.
